ZIP CODE TABULATION AREA

83414

Wyoming · 502 residents · 342.722 sq mi
Compare

Population has held roughly steady since 2024. 65%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, well above the national rate of 36%. Median home value is $1,285,000. With a median age of 61.5, the population is older than the US median of 38.9. Poverty is rare here, at 5.0% of residents.
